In the realm of Digital Land Economics, a fascinating dichotomy emerges: scarcity versus infinite space. Traditional land economics dictates that as resources become scarce, their value increases. However, the digital landscape, with its boundless virtual expanse, challenges this notion. As we venture into the metaverse and the world of NFTs, the concept of scarcity is redefined, making digital land a unique asset class. Here, value isn't solely determined by physical limitations but by the community, utility, and the innovative ways digital spaces can be curated and experienced. This tension between the finite and the infinite is reshaping our understanding of economics in the digital age.
